** The Nissan repair market for Ryderwood residents is entirely dependent on nearby cities, primarily Longview (~20-minute drive) and, to a lesser extent, Chehalis (~30-minute drive). The market is characterized by a handful of high-quality independent shops that have filled the niche for specialized Japanese auto repair, as the nearest Nissan dealerships are significantly farther away in Vancouver or Olympia. Competition among these top independents is strong, driving a high standard of quality and customer service. Typical pricing is competitive, generally 20-30% lower than dealership rates, while still offering expert-level knowledge. For highly specialized services like in-depth GT-R performance tuning or complex hybrid system repairs, owners may still need to travel to larger metropolitan centers, but for the vast majority of Nissan service needs, the providers in Longview are exceptionally well-equipped and reputable.

Given Ryderwood's rural, forested setting and often damp climate, common issues include CVT transmission concerns, brake corrosion from moisture, and suspension wear from unpaved or rough roads. Nissan models like the Rogue and Altima frequently need attention for these local driving condition-related problems.

Seek immediate service if you notice unusual CVT transmission behavior like shuddering or hesitation on hills, significant loss of braking power, or warning lights like the ABS or Slip indicator. These are critical for safety on Ryderwood's remote, often slippery roads.
Prioritize more frequent undercarriage inspections for rust prevention due to high moisture, and ensure your all-wheel-drive system (if equipped) is serviced to handle loose gravel and mud. Also, plan ahead for repairs, as local shops may have limited availability, requiring scheduling appointments well in advance.
